Poopara, Poopara, Idukki, Kerala, India, 685619
Ad ID 957 2017-04-27
At a Glance : Located in Pooppara , Specilised in: HPCL Dealer, Guest House & Refreshing Centre
Dt : 2017-04-27
Type
Feature
Thomas Varkey & Sons
04868 247595 04868247595